2351 N Lincoln Ave
Chicago, IL 60614
Enjoy Happy Hour for dine-in or carryout Monday through Saturday from 3 to 6pm. All day Sunday Happy Hour will be offered for dine-in only.
Find your favorite sustainable, feel-good sushi in the heart of Lincoln Park at Lincoln Common.